Respectful Interactions

Guidelines for positive cultural exchanges during your visit.

Courtesy Guidelines

  • Seek permission before photographing people, especially women and children
  • Dress modestly, especially when visiting religious sites
  • Remove shoes before entering temples and some homes
  • Bargain respectfully in markets, avoid aggressive negotiation

Religious Site Protocol

Adhere to specific customs within sacred spaces to show reverence.

Temple Conduct

  • Dress modestly, covering shoulders and knees
  • Remove footwear outside the main temple area
  • Avoid touching idols or sacred objects
  • Maintain silence or speak softly within the temple premises
